The Economic Burden of Cardiovascular Disease in the United States

Insights

Cardiovascular disease (CVD) is a leading cause of death and healthcare costs in the US. Addressing this crisis requires comprehensive strategies focusing on prevention, equity, and efficiency to reduce financial burdens and improve outcomes.

Background:

  • Cardiovascular disease (CVD) is the primary cause of death in the US, significantly impacting healthcare expenditures.
  • Annual costs, including direct medical expenses and indirect losses from reduced productivity, exceed $500 billion and are projected to double by 2035.
  • Disparities in financial burden exist, disproportionately affecting women, older adults, and minority populations, exacerbating health inequities.

Purpose of the Study:

  • To highlight the substantial economic impact of cardiovascular disease in the United States.
  • To identify key areas for intervention to mitigate costs and improve patient outcomes.
  • To underscore the need for a multifaceted approach to manage CVD's financial and health consequences.

Main Methods:

  • This analysis synthesizes data on direct and indirect costs associated with cardiovascular disease.
  • It examines cost variations across different healthcare systems.
  • The study reviews demographic data on financial burden distribution.

Main Results:

  • Cardiovascular disease costs exceed $500 billion annually, with projections surpassing $1 trillion by 2035.
  • Significant cost variations across health systems indicate inefficiencies and inequities.
  • Women, older adults, and racial/ethnic minorities face a disproportionate financial burden, worsening health disparities.

Conclusions:

  • A comprehensive strategy is essential to combat the cardiovascular disease crisis.
  • Key elements include prevention, equitable access to care, value-based care models, and waste reduction through administrative streamlining and fair pricing.
  • Sustainable approaches are crucial for improving health outcomes, controlling costs, and reducing disparities amidst rising CVD prevalence.
